Course overview
This training provides speech-language pathologists (SLPs) with a comprehensive overview of fundamental ethics, legal principles, and best practices for navigating dilemmas in clinical settings. Participants will explore real-world case studies, learn essential decision-making frameworks, and gain valuable insight into legal considerations impacting their practice. You'll be sure to walk away with the knowledge, confidence and tools to uphold standards of care, ensure compliance, and make informed on-the-spot decisions that prioritize patient well-being and professional integrity.
